## Weather-alert fan-out (reviewer notes)

Stormrelay fans out alerts from the Pellworth ingest feed to push, SMS, and email workers. Review focus: dedup keys (alerts can arrive twice), region-filter logic, and backpressure on the SMS lane. Never block the ingest loop. Architecture diagram and delivery guarantees are documented on the team's internal page.

runbook for tajep-yahig: https://artifactory.lumictech.corp/repo

Heads up for the release manager: the Lintbarrow static-analysis baseline file drifted again. Someone regenerated it on a machine with different path separators, so half the suppressions stopped matching and CI went red on untouched code. I've normalized the paths and re-pinned the baseline to the release branch. Please don't let anyone regenerate it locally before the cut — use the pipeline job instead. The corrected baseline ships with the build noted by the token below.

session token of bawep-yadup = htk21_528abd376e3c5a4ec24a1

## Deployment

The billing worker (Ledgerline) ships via blue-green on our Quarrow cluster, so reviewers: don't panic when you see two full environments in the manifest — that's intentional. Traffic flips at the load balancer only after the green stack passes the invoice-replay smoke test, and the blue stack lingers for 30 minutes as a rollback target. Merges to main trigger the whole dance automatically; nothing manual unless the smoke test fails twice. The flip logic and timings are driven entirely by the settings below.

settings of fafog-haduf:
ZORIX_PIN=4648
ZORIX_METRICS_HOST=metrics.zorix.paliqsys.corp
ZORIX_LOG_LEVEL=info
ZORIX_TENANT=druix

**Handover — Pinning Policy (Corvid Build)**

To release manager: all Corvid deps now pinned to exact versions; weekly bump job opens PRs Mondays. Don't merge unpinned transitive upgrades. Lockfile audits run in CI; failures block release. Emergency unpin needs the recovery account — authenticate with the passphrase below.

unlock words, kagef-taduf: fenir-quenix-norwyn-sorvan-gormir-gorir-fraok